The PIC18LF25K83-E/MX is a microcontroller belonging to the PIC18 family, designed and manufactured by Microchip Technology. The PIC18LF25K83-E/MX features a 28-pin UQFN package with specific pin assignments for power, communication, I/O, and other functions. The detailed pin configuration can be found in the official datasheet provided by Microchip Technology.
The PIC18LF25K83-E/MX operates based on the Harvard architecture, featuring separate program and data memories. It executes instructions fetched from program memory and interacts with peripherals and I/O devices to perform specific tasks as programmed by the user.
The PIC18LF25K83-E/MX is well-suited for a wide range of embedded control applications, including but not limited to: - Home automation systems - Industrial control systems - Sensor interfacing and data acquisition - Consumer electronics - Automotive control systems

What is the maximum operating frequency of PIC18LF25K83-E/MX?
- The maximum operating frequency of PIC18LF25K83-E/MX is 64 MHz.
What are the key features of PIC18LF25K83-E/MX?
- Some key features of PIC18LF25K83-E/MX include 32 KB Flash program memory, 2 KB RAM, and 256 bytes of EEPROM data memory.
Can PIC18LF25K83-E/MX be used for motor control applications?
- Yes, PIC18LF25K83-E/MX can be used for motor control applications due to its enhanced capture/compare/PWM (ECCP) peripherals.
Does PIC18LF25K83-E/MX support communication protocols like SPI and I2C?
- Yes, PIC18LF25K83-E/MX supports communication protocols such as SPI and I2C.
What development tools are available for programming PIC18LF25K83-E/MX?
- Development tools such as MPLAB X IDE and MPLAB Code Configurator can be used for programming PIC18LF25K83-E/MX.
Is PIC18LF25K83-E/MX suitable for low-power applications?
- Yes, PIC18LF25K83-E/MX is suitable for low-power applications with its low-power modes and features.
